Director Of Information Under Kalyan Singh, Anup Chandra Pandey Is Uttar Pradesh New Chief Secretary

Anup Chandra Pandey is the new Chief Secretary of Uttar Pradesh (UP) administration. He is replacing Rajiv Kumar for the post who is retiring on 30 June. Pandey is a 1984 batch IAS officer. He is currently the Industrial Development Commissioner. According to this report in Dainik Jagran, the government was impressed with Pandey’s role in organisating the Investor’s Summit in February and hence decided to promote him as Chief Secretary. Notably, Pandey was also the Director of Information in the government of Kalyan Singh.
As chief secretary, Pandey is expected to have his task cut out. The incumbent Bharatiya Janta Party (BJP) wants to repeat its performance of 2014, where it won 71 out of 80 Lok Sabha seats of UP, next year. For this, the primary schemes of the both the central and state government need to show results on ground. In a State of the size and population of Uttar Pradesh, that is not an easy task.
